Output 86d66e3c2b06cc810bc9869a98b61d8b7539a8b9703742fbb3b3ee88a64a587c:1

value
7650430
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 753bf4732edeae1fe2b60664aff199aa7fb451e211e024b2bf5b213344a2e387
address
bc1pw5alguewm6hplc4kqej2luve4flmg50zz8szfv4ltvsnx39zuwrs4sr49e
transaction
86d66e3c2b06cc810bc9869a98b61d8b7539a8b9703742fbb3b3ee88a64a587c
spent
true